Subject: drm/vmwgfx: Move surface copy cmd to atomic function
Git-commit: 4e2f9fa7ffb5324adfc62fa3da6e1e36827fd5ad
Patch-mainline: v4.17-rc1
References: FATE#326289 FATE#326079 FATE#326049 FATE#322398 FATE#326166

When display surface is different than the framebuffer surface, atomic
path do not copy the surface data. This commit moved the code to copy
surface from legacy to atomic path.
